Calories in ORGANIC MULTIGRAIN WAFFLES

Serving Size: 1 Serving (70.0g)
Amount Per Serving
  • Calories 179.9
  • Total Fat 7.0 g
  • Saturated Fat 1.0 g
  • Cholesterol 0.0 mg
  • Sodium 329.7 mg
  • Potassium 0.0 mg
  • Total Carbohydrate 28.0 g
  • Dietary Fiber 2.0 g
  • Sugars 5.0 g
  • Protein 4.0 g

Ingredients

WATER, ORGANIC WHOLE WHEAT FLOUR, ORGANIC ENRICHED WHEAT FLOUR (ORGANIC WHEAT FLOUR, NIACIN, REDUCED IRON, THIAMIN MONONITRATE [VITAMIN B1], RIBOFLAVIN [VITAMIN B2], FOLIC ACID), ORGANIC VEGETABLE OIL (ORGANIC CANOLA OIL AND/OR ORGANIC SOYBEAN OIL), ORGANIC CANE SUGAR, CONTAINS 2% OR LESS OF: LEAVENING (SODIUM ACID PYROPHOSPHATE, SODIUM BICARBONATE, MONOCALCIUM PHOSPHATE), ORGANIC WHEAT BRAN, ORGANIC SOY LECITHIN, ORGANIC BARLEY FLOUR, ORGANIC BROWN RICE FLOUR, ORGANIC CORN FLOUR, ORGANIC OAT BRAN, ORGANIC RYE FLOUR, ORGANIC SKIM MILK, SEA SALT, ORGANIC EGGS.

Calorie Analysis

The food ORGANIC MULTIGRAIN WAFFLES, based on the serving size listed above, would account for 9% of your daily allotted calories based on a 2,000 calorie diet. The majority of the calories for this food comes from carbohydrates. Carbohydrates make up 62.3% of the calories.
